Cheap bus tickets from Deerfield Beach, FL to Sebring, FL can start from as little as €36 when you book in advance. The average bus ticket price for Deerfield Beach, FL to Sebring, FL is €38 ; however, prices vary depending on the time of day and class and they tend to be more expensive on the day.
The average journey time by bus from Deerfield Beach, FL to Sebring, FL is 6h 15m to travel the 116 miles (187 km) long journey. Journey times can vary on weekends and holidays, so use our Journey Planner to search for a specific date.
The earliest bus from Deerfield Beach, FL to Sebring, FL leaves at 6:50 AM. Plan your trip with the Journey Planner from Omio.
The latest bus from Deerfield Beach, FL to Sebring, FL leaves at 4:30 PM.
When departing from Deerfield Beach, FL , you have various bus station options to start your journey from including Boca Raton, Trirail Station, FL, Fort Lauderdale, NW 22nd Ave, FL, Hollywood, Sheridan Street (Tri-Rail Station), FL, Boynton Beach, High Ridge Rd (Greyhound Bus Station), FL . When arriving in Sebring, FL , you can end your journey in bus stations like Sebring, US-27 (Greyhound Bus Stop), FL, Avon Park, US Hwy 98 (Murphy Express), FL .Passengers board the bus most frequently from Boca Raton, Trirail Station, FL, which is located around 2 miles (4 km) away from the city centre, and they get off the bus at Sebring, US-27 (Greyhound Bus Stop), FL, located 3 away from the city centre.
